  • The Commercial Real Estate market market in Bosnia and Herzegovina is expected to reach a value of US$26.93bn by 2024.
  • It is projected to have an annual growth rate (CAGR 2024-2029) of 1.34%, leading to a market volume of US$28.78bn by 2029.

Methodology

Data coverage:

Figures are based on value of commercial real estate.

Modeling approach / Market size:

Market sizes are determined by a bottom-up approach. As a basis for evaluating this market, we use national statistical offices. Next, we use relevant key market indicators and data from country-specific associations such as share of industry, manufacturing, and services of the GPD, price level index, GDP. This data helps us to estimate the market size for each country individually.

Forecasts:

In our forecasts, we apply diverse forecasting techniques. The selection of forecasting techniques is based on the behavior of the market, for example, exponential trend smoothing.

Additional Notes:

The market is updated twice per year in case market dynamics change. The impacts of the Russia-Ukraine war are considered at a country-specific level.
